What Is Solidified Carbon Dioxide Cleaning?



Solidified carbon dioxide cleaning, also referred to as carbon dioxide cleansing, is a cutting-edge approach that makes use of strong carbon dioxide pellets to remove contaminants from various surfaces. This technique works by accelerating solidified carbon dioxide pellets with a nozzle, producing a powerful jet that blasts away dirt, oil, and other unwanted materials. You'll discover it reliable on a wide variety of surface areas, consisting of metal, wood, and also fragile electronic devices.


Among the ideal components? It doesn't leave any type of deposit because the dry ice sublimates directly into gas upon contact with the surface area. You will not require to stress over water damage or chemical residues, making it eco pleasant. Plus, dry ice cleaning is reliable and quick, permitting you to recover surfaces without prolonged downtime. Whether you're keeping equipment or preparing surface areas for paint, this technique can conserve you time and trouble, making it a best remedy in modern surface restoration.


The Scientific Research Behind Solidified Carbon Dioxide Cleansing





Utilizing the concepts of thermodynamics and kinetic power, completely dry ice cleaning properly gets rid of impurities from surfaces. When you spray dry ice pellets onto a surface area, they swiftly sublimate, transforming from strong to gas. This process develops a remarkable decrease in temperature level, triggering contaminants to end up being brittle and loosen their bond with the surface.




As the pellets affect the surface, they move kinetic energy, properly removing dirt, grease, and various other undesirable products. The CO2 gas generated during sublimation expands and creates small shockwaves, additionally assisting in the removal of these contaminants.


This cleansing approach is non-abrasive and leaves no residue behind, making it suitable for fragile surface areas. You do not require to bother with severe chemicals or water damages, as dry ice cleansing is both reliable and eco-friendly. By understanding this science, you can appreciate how dry ice cleaning provides a distinct solution for surface remediation.


Advantages of Solidified Carbon Dioxide Cleansing in Various Industries



While numerous cleaning techniques have their place, dry ice cleansing stands apart throughout different industries for its unique benefits. In manufacturing, you'll value how it effectively removes grease and pollutants without damaging delicate equipment components. In the food sector, it's a game-changer, making certain surface areas continue to be sterilized without leaving deposits that can jeopardize food safety and security.


In the vehicle market, solidified carbon dioxide cleaning can renew engine parts, improving performance without the threat of water damages. Even in the restoration of historical buildings, it eliminates years of crud while protecting the original products.


You'll locate that this technique is eco-friendly, as it uses no hazardous chemicals, and it decreases waste. Plus, considering that it requires less downtime, you'll save both money and time. By selecting solidified carbon dioxide cleaning, you're not simply choosing for a cleansing service; you're welcoming a superior means to keep and recover surface areas across different industries.

Environmental Impact of Dry Ice Cleansing



While lots of cleaning methods can harm the setting, completely dry ice cleansing stands apart as a lasting choice. This cutting-edge technique makes use of strong carbon dioxide pellets that sublimate upon impact, developing no waste or harmful byproducts. You're not simply improving surface areas; you're also making an eco-friendly option. when you choose completely dry ice cleaning.


Unlike traditional cleansing approaches that typically count on hazardous chemicals, dry ice cleaning is safe and risk-free for both employees and the setting. It decreases water usage, which is necessary in locations encountering water shortage. Plus, given that dry ice sublimates, there's no messy deposit left behind, suggesting less cleanup and disposal.
